The Korean peninsula is a core problem to the security of the Northeast Asia. The Korean Peninsula issue is the result of the Cold War in history, meanwhile, it’s a "battlefield" that both side of the peninsula contend with each other. A change in policy, the leader change or even a fortuitous event can be a key point that influence the peace and stability of the Korean peninsula.On Feb.25th2008, Lee Myung-bak became the17th president of Republic of Korea. The new government changed the "Reconciliation and Cooperation" policy toward North Korea which had been executed for10years by the democratic reformer, and proposed a new pragmatic foreign policy, which is centered in the national benefits. Lee Myung-bak government paid more attention on "Alliance and Power" which intends to pursue a tough policy to denuclearize the Korean Peninsula and advance policy target of Korean reunification. The pragmatic foreign policy reflects the ruling idea of Lee Myung-bak government which definitely affect the North-South relations and the security and stability of Northeast Asia.The main content of pragmatic foreign policy of Lee Myung-bak government seeks to strengthen the ROK-US Alliance and take "New Thought" towards Japan; and it also aims at adjusting the policies toward North Korea and pursuing "Limited" balanced foreign policy. However, during4years, the implementation of the pragmatic foreign policy has been through ups and downs, especially the "Denuclearization, Openness,3000" policy was strongly protested by North Korea, who cut off dialogue with South Korea and even expelled11South Korean officials from the joint industrial park in Kaesong to express dissatisfaction, North Korea exerted strong military pressure on South Korea by suddenly moving its Elite Squad815Mechanization army to south after routine training. Then the Cheonan incident and Yeonpyeong shelling shock the whole world, and deteriorate the relationship between two countries. Six-Party Talks comes to a deadlock, the northeast Asia security situation deteriorate, inter-Korean relation retrogresses, even on the verge of breaking out a fight.Obviously, the pragmatic foreign policy of Lee Myung-bak government is much realistic than the policy pursued by Roh Moo-hyun government. First, it enhances the ROK-US Alliance, recovering the US-Japan-ROK coordination mechanism to get enough power to pressure North Korea. Second, in order to further extend and implement tough policy toward North Korea and win strategic space, they expand substantive cooperation with China and Russia in various fields, such as economy, politics, diplomacy, security and defense by improving the relations with China and Russia at the level of "strategic partnership".The current inter-Korean relation is not as stable as that in Roh Moo-hyun government, however, dialogue and cooperation between the two countries which placing their common interests above anything else will still be the mainstream of the development of inter-Korean relations. Inter-Korean Relations will make improvement through all these hardships.
